>> does anyone have the dimensions of the metal piece on later cars for
>> holding down the dash vinyl? My car doesn't have it, and the dash is lifting. I
>> haven't seen it on the vendor's sites. Also, how is it connected/fastened?
>>
>
>They were secured with tiny, tiny screws, almost like the screws used in
>eyeglasses. They were never a stand-alone part from De Tomaso; the Ford part
>number is D16Y-6304200-A. The long retainer is 16 inches, and the short one is,
>well, short. The long one had three screws, the short one had two, and when
>the screws are installed you basically can't see them, they're so small.
>
>TSB #5, article 31.
>
>There are lots of Pre-L dashes gathering dust in Pantera shops, and so you
>can probably get some from one of them.
